Minutes — Management Meeting, Tallowfield Instruments

Present: J. Corbeau, A. Winsett, P. Drale. The meeting confirmed retirement of the Merlane gauge line effective next fiscal year. Remaining inventory will be sold through branch channels at standard margin; no clearance pricing before formal announcement. Service contracts honoured for 18 months. Branch managers to identify customers needing migration support by month-end. Messaging templates follow next week. The related confidential business direction is recorded directly below.

board note of bawep-tajef: Queniusek Systems plans to raise the Quenvan list price by 53.1 percent in March. The pricing group signed off on a budget of $176.4 million for Project Drueth. The renewal with Casionix Partners closes at $142.5 million a year, 8.3 percent below the last contract. Project Fraax slips by six weeks because of the tooling delay.

# Basement Archive Room — Night Access

The archive room under Pellworth House holds old contracts and the tape backups. Night shift: take stairwell C, not the lift (it's switched off after midnight). Lights are on a timer by the door — slap the button as you go in. Sign the logbook, even at 3am, yes really. The keypad by the door takes the code below.

staff pass of fahap-tajeg = bdg-FT-6

## Formula sandbox tuning

User-supplied formulas in Gridmoor execute inside a restricted interpreter with hard ceilings on time, memory, and call depth. Reviewers should confirm any change to these ceilings is justified in the PR description, since raising them widens the abuse surface. Defaults were chosen from production traces. The current limits are as follows.

limits module of tafog-fawip:
WEIGHTS = {
    "julix": 57,
    "lamys": 992,
    "kasvan": 209,
    "quenok": 750,
    "alddor": 259,
    "oliath": 1009,
    "wenix": 815,
}